Output 45d2d8a207c8bbf5c64a4ddaa5f66d41cfdaba3188c8bda37f2be226344b4b8f:2

value
619476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0173ad2d117b8cd1cb8ba833208e89dc7f0a7fa6 OP_EQUAL
address
31phB5T8cGE3WQMgr5GqdBEDNrJJLKyVku
transaction
45d2d8a207c8bbf5c64a4ddaa5f66d41cfdaba3188c8bda37f2be226344b4b8f
confirmations
429352
spent
true